Final Conclusions
In conclusion, selecting the right employee experience management software is crucial for organizations aiming to enhance employee engagement and satisfaction. The key features to consider when making this decision include seamless integration with existing HR systems, user-friendly interface, real-time feedback capabilities, robust analytics, and customizable surveys. By prioritizing these features, organizations can effectively improve the overall employee experience, leading to increased productivity, retention, and ultimately, the achievement of business objectives.
